Tour de Hokkaido Underway

September 13th, 2007 by James

Cool news out of Hokkaido (video included):

The Tour de Hokkaido, Japan’s largest bicycle race, got under way on Thursday, organizers said.

Five teams from overseas and 15 Japanese teams, each consisting of five racers, will compete on the 677-kilometer course in central and southern Hokkaido in six stages over a five-day period.
